Explanation:
Mr Smith appoints the following people:
2 hall moniters for every hallway
4 supervisors for every 20 hall monitors.
There is 30 hallways
From this information we can determine the amount of of all monitors for 30 hallways as:

Therefore Mr Smith appoints 60 hall monitors.
We can calculate the number of supervisors per hall monitors:
[ted]=4/20=1/5[/tex]
Therefore we can determine the amount of supervisors Mr. Smith needs to appoint is:

Mr. Smith will need to appoint 12 supervisors for 60 hall monitors.
